That’s former Panamanian dictator Manuel Noriega aboard a U.S. military transport plane in January 1990 after surrendering during Operation Just Cause.
He's wearing heavy noise-canceling ear defenders and blackout goggles (sensory deprivation gear) so he couldn't figure out where he was being flown or communicate with anyone on the flight to Miami.
